Amicii Dog Rescue is a UK based charity, which was established to support a dog rescue shelter in Transylvania, Western Romania. The shelter cares for up to 300 dogs at any one time and is run by Asociatia Amicii Nostri, a registered NGO.The dogs that live at the shelter have mainly come from the streets of Viioara, Câmpia Turzii and Turda. Some dogs are abandoned at the shelter, for example they have been thrown over the fence or left in cardboard boxes! Others have been abandoned by their owners and taken into the care of the shelter team, whilst some are taken from the state public shelter in Turda.
